# P4Transfer.py
#
# This python script will transfer Perforce changelists with all contents
# between independent servers when no remote depots are possible.
#
# This script transfers changes in one direction - from a source server to a target server.
# There is an alternative called PerforceExchange.py which transfers changes
# in both directions.
#
# Usage:
#   python2 P4Transfer.py [options]
#
# The -h/--help option describes all options.
#
# The script requires a config file, normally called transfer.cfg,
# that provides the Perforce connection information for both servers.
# The config file has three sections: [general], [source] and [target].
# See DEFAULT_CONFIG for details. An initial example can be generated, e.g.
#
#   P4Transfer.py --sample_config > transfer.cfg
#
# The script also needs a directory in which it can place the mapped files.
# This directory has to be the root of both servers' workspaces (this will be verified).

from __future__ import print_function

VERSION = """$Id: //guest/perforce_software/p4transfer/P4Transfer.py#9 $"""

import sys, re
from collections import OrderedDict
import P4
import pprint

def logrepr(self):
    return pprint.pformat(self.__dict__, width=240)

# Log messages just once per run
alreadyLogged = {}
def logOnce(logger, *args):
    global alreadyLogged
    msg = ", ".join([str(x) for x in args])
    if not msg in alreadyLogged:
        alreadyLogged[msg] = 1
        logger.debug(msg)

P4.Revision.__repr__ = logrepr
P4.Integration.__repr__ = logrepr
P4.DepotFile.__repr__ = logrepr

python3 = sys.version_info[0] >= 3

# Although this should work with Python 3, it doesn't currently handle Windows Perforce servers
# with filenames containing charaters such as umlauts etc: åäö
if python3:
    from configparser import ConfigParser
else:
    from ConfigParser import ConfigParser

import argparse
import os.path
from datetime import datetime
import logging
import time

import logutils

CONFIG = 'transfer.cfg'
GENERAL_SECTION = 'general'
SOURCE_SECTION = 'source'
TARGET_SECTION = 'target'
LOGGER_NAME = "P4Transfer"

# This is for writing to sample config file - OrderedDict used to preserve order of lines.
DEFAULT_CONFIG = OrderedDict({
    GENERAL_SECTION: OrderedDict([
        ("# counter_name: Unique counter on target server to use for recording source changes processed. No spaces.", None),
        ("#    Name sensibly if you have multiple instances transferring into the same target p4 repository.", None),
        ("#    The counter value represents the last transferred change number - script will start from next change.", None),
        ("#    If not set, or 0 then transfer will start from first change.", None),
        ("counter_name", "p4transfer_counter"),
        ("# instance_name: Name of the instance of P4Transfer - for emails etc. Spaces allowed.", None),
        ("instance_name", "Perforce Transfer from XYZ"),
        ("# For notification - testing purposes only", None),
        ("mail_form_url", ""),
        ("# The mail_* parameters must all be valid (non-blank) to receive email updates during processing. ", None),
        ("# mail_to: One or more valid email addresses - comma separated for multiple values", None),
        ("#     E.g. [email protected],[email protected]", None),
        ("mail_to", ""),
        ("# mail_from: Email address of sender of emails, E.g. [email protected]", None),
        ("mail_from", ""),
        ("# mail_server: The SMTP server to connect to for email sending, E.g. smtpserver.example.com", None),
        ("mail_server", ""),
        ("# sleep_on_error_interval: How long (in minutes) to sleep when error is encountered in the script", None),
        ("sleep_on_error_interval", "60"),
        ("# poll_interval: How long (in minutes) to wait between polling source server for new changes", None),
        ("poll_interval", "60"),
        ("# The following *_interval values result in reports, but only if mail_* values are specified", None),
        ("# report_interval: Interval (in minutes) between regular update emails being sent", None),
        ("report_interval", "30"),
        ("# error_report_interval: Interval (in minutes) between error emails being sent e.g. connection error", None),
        ("#     Usually some value less than report_interval. Useful if transfer being run with --repeat option.", None),
        ("error_report_interval", "15"),
        ("# summary_report_interval: Interval (in minutes) between summary emails being sent e.g. changes processed", None),
        ("#     Typically some value such as 1 week (10080 = 7 * 24 *60). Useful if transfer being run with --repeat option.", None),
        ("summary_report_interval", "10080"),
        ("# sync_progress_size_interval: Size in bytes controlling when syncs are reported to log file. ", None),
        ("#    Useful for keeping an eye on progress for large syncs over slow links. ", None),
        ("sync_progress_size_interval", "500000000")]),
    SOURCE_SECTION: OrderedDict([
        ("# P4PORT to connect to, e.g. some-server:1666", None),
        ("p4port", ""),
        ("# P4USER to use", None),
        ("p4user", ""),
        ("# P4CLIENT to use, e.g. p4-transfer-client", None),
        ("p4client", ""),
        ("# P4PASSWD for the user - valid password. If blank then no login performed.", None),
        ("p4passwd", "")]),
    TARGET_SECTION: OrderedDict([
        ("# P4PORT to connect to, e.g. some-server:1666", None),
        ("p4port", ""),
        ("# P4USER to use", None),
        ("p4user", ""),
        ("# P4CLIENT to use, e.g. p4-transfer-client", None),
        ("p4client", ""),
        ("# P4PASSWD for the user - valid password. If blank then no login performed.", None),
        ("p4passwd", "")]),
    })

def p4time(unixtime):
    "Convert time to Perforce format time"
    return time.strftime("%Y/%m/%d:%H:%M:%S", time.localtime(unixtime))

def printSampleConfig():
    "Print defaults from above dictionary for saving as a base file"
    config = ConfigParser(allow_no_value=True)
    for sec in DEFAULT_CONFIG.keys():
        config.add_section(sec)
        for k in DEFAULT_CONFIG[sec].keys():
            config.set(sec, k, DEFAULT_CONFIG[sec][k])
    print("")
    print("# Save this output to a file to e.g. transfer.cfg and edit it for your configuration")
    print("")
    config.write(sys.stdout)

def fmtsize(num):
    for x in ['bytes','KB','MB','GB','TB']:
        if num < 1024.0:
            return "%3.1f %s" % (num, x)
        num /= 1024.0

class ChangeRevision:
    "Represents a change - created from P4API supplied information and thus encoding"

    def __init__(self, r, a, t, d):
        self.rev = r
        self.action = a
        self.type = t
        self.depotFile = d
        self.localFile = None

    def setIntegrationInfo(self, integ):
        self.integration = integ

    def setLocalFile(self, localFile):
        self.localFile = localFile
        localFile = localFile.replace("%40", "@")
        localFile = localFile.replace("%23", "#")
        localFile = localFile.replace("%2A", "*")
        localFile = localFile.replace("%25", "%")
        localFile = localFile.replace("/", os.sep)
        self.fixedLocalFile = localFile

    def __repr__(self):
        return 'rev = {rev} action = {action} type = {type} depotFile = {depotfile}' .format(
            rev=self.rev,
            action=self.action,
            type=self.type,
            depotfile=self.depotFile,
        )

class ReportProgress(object):
    "Report overall progress"

    def __init__(self, p4, changes, logger):
        self.logger = logger
        self.filesToSync = 0
        self.changesToSync = len(changes)
        self.sizeToSync = 0
        self.filesSynced = 0
        self.changesSynced = 0
        self.sizeSynced = 0
        self.previousSizeSynced = 0
        self.sync_progress_size_interval = None     # Set to integer value to get reports
        for chg in changes:
            sizes = p4.run('sizes', '-s', '@%s,%s' % (chg['change'], chg['change']))
            self.sizeToSync += int(sizes[0]['fileSize'])
            self.filesToSync += int(sizes[0]['fileCount'])
        self.logger.info("Syncing %d changes, files %d, size %s" % (self.changesToSync,
                        self.filesToSync, fmtsize(self.sizeToSync)))

    def SetSyncProgressSizeInterval(self, interval):
        "Set appropriate"
        if interval:
            self.sync_progress_size_interval = int(interval)

    def ReportChangeSync(self):
        self.changesSynced += 1

    def ReportFileSync(self, fileSize):
        self.filesSynced += 1
        self.sizeSynced += fileSize
        if not self.sync_progress_size_interval:
            return
        if self.sizeSynced > self.previousSizeSynced + self.sync_progress_size_interval:
            self.previousSizeSynced = self.sizeSynced
            syncPercent = 100 * float(self.filesSynced) / float(self.filesToSync)
            sizePercent = 100 * float(self.sizeSynced) / float(self.sizeToSync)
            self.logger.info("Synced %d/%d changes, files %d/%d (%2.1f %%), size %s/%s (%2.1f %%)" % ( \
                    self.changesSynced, self.changesToSync,
                    self.filesSynced, self.filesToSync, syncPercent,
                    fmtsize(self.sizeSynced), fmtsize(self.sizeToSync),
                    sizePercent))

class P4Base(object):
    "Processes a config"

    section = None
    P4PORT = None
    P4CLIENT = None
    P4USER = None
    P4PASSWD = None
    counter = 0
    clientLogged = 0

    def __init__(self, section, options, p4id):
        self.section = section
        self.options = options
        self.logger = logging.getLogger(LOGGER_NAME)
        self.p4id = p4id
        self.p4 = None
        self.client_logged = 0

    def __str__(self):
        return '[section = {} P4PORT = {} P4CLIENT = {} P4USER = {} P4PASSWD = {}]'.format( \
            self.section,
            self.P4PORT,
            self.P4CLIENT,
            self.P4USER,
            self.P4PASSWD,
            )

    def connect(self, progname):
        self.p4 = P4.P4()
        self.p4.port = self.P4PORT
        self.p4.client = self.P4CLIENT
        self.p4.user = self.P4USER
        self.p4.prog = progname
        self.p4.exception_level = P4.P4.RAISE_ERROR
        self.p4.connect()
        if not self.P4PASSWD == None:
            self.p4.password = self.P4PASSWD
            self.p4.run_login()

        clientspec = self.p4.fetch_client(self.p4.client)
        logOnce(self.logger, "%s:%s:%s" % (self.p4id, self.p4.client, pprint.pformat(clientspec)))
        self.root = clientspec._root
        self.p4.cwd = self.root
        self.clientmap = P4.Map(clientspec._view)

        ctr = P4.Map('//"'+clientspec._client+'/..."   "' + clientspec._root + '/..."')
        self.localmap = P4.Map.join(self.clientmap, ctr)
        self.depotmap = self.localmap.reverse()

    def p4cmd(self, *args):
        "Execute p4 cmd while logging arguments and results"
        self.logger.debug(self.p4id, args)
        output = self.p4.run(args)
        self.logger.debug(self.p4id, output)
        return output

    def disconnect(self):
        if self.p4:
            self.p4.disconnect()

    def checkWarnings(self, where):
        if self.p4 and self.p4.warnings:
            self.logger.warning('warning in {} : {}'.format(where, str(self.p4.warnings)))

    def resetWorkspace(self):
        self.p4cmd('sync', '...#none')

class TrackedAdd(object):
    """Record class used in MoveTracker"""
    def __init__(self, chRev, deleteDepotFile):
        self.chRev = chRev
        self.deleteDepotFile = deleteDepotFile

class MoveTracker(object):
    """Tracks move/add and move/delete and handles orphans where 
    source or target isn't mapped (either outside source workspace or not
    visible due to permissions)."""
        
    def __init__(self, logger):
        self.logger = logger
        self.adds = {}       # Key is localFile for matching delete
        self.deletes = {}    # Key is localFile for delete
        
    def trackAdd(self, chRev, localFile, deleteDepotFile, deleteLocalFile):
        "Remember the move/add or move/delete so we can match them up"
        self.adds[deleteLocalFile] = TrackedAdd(chRev, deleteDepotFile)
    
    def trackDelete(self, chRev, localFile):
        "Track a move/delete"
        self.deletes[localFile] = chRev
        
    def getMoves(self):
        "Return orphaned moves, or the move/add from add/delete pairs"
        for localFile in self.adds:
            if localFile in self.deletes:
                self.logger.debug("Matched move add/delete '%s'" % localFile)
                del self.deletes[localFile]
            else:
                self.logger.debug("Action move/add changed to add")
                self.adds[localFile].chRev.action = "add"
        result = [self.adds[k].chRev for k in self.adds]
        for k in self.deletes:
            self.logger.debug("Action move/delete changed to delete")
            self.deletes[k].action = 'delete'
        result.extend([self.deletes[k] for k in self.deletes])
        return result

class P4Source(P4Base):
    "Functionality for reading from source Perforce repository"

    def __init__(self, section, options):
        super(P4Source, self).__init__(section, options, 'src')

    def missingChanges(self, counter):
        changes = self.p4cmd('changes', '-l', '...@{rev},#head'.format(rev=counter + 1))
        changes.reverse()
        if self.options.maximum:
            changes = changes[:self.options.maximum]
        return changes

    def getChange(self, change):
        """Expects change number as a string"""

        class SyncOutput(P4.OutputHandler):
            "Log sync progress"

            def __init__(self, progress):
                P4.OutputHandler.__init__(self)
                self.progress = progress

            def outputStat(self, stat):
                if 'fileSize' in stat:
                    self.progress.ReportFileSync(int(stat['fileSize']))
                return P4.OutputHandler.HANDLED

            def outputInfo(self, info):
                return P4.OutputHandler.HANDLED

            def outputMessage(self, msg):
                return P4.OutputHandler.HANDLED

        self.progress.ReportChangeSync()
        callback = SyncOutput(self.progress)
        self.p4.run('sync', '...@{},{}'.format(change, change), handler=callback)
        change = self.p4cmd('describe', change)[0]
        filerevs = []
        movetracker = MoveTracker(self.logger)
        for (n, rev) in enumerate(change['rev']):
            localFile = self.localmap.translate(change['depotFile'][n])
            if localFile and len(localFile) > 0:
                chRev = ChangeRevision(rev, change['action'][n], change['type'][n], change['depotFile'][n])
                chRev.setLocalFile(localFile)
                if chRev.action in ('branch', 'integrate', 'add', 'delete', 'move/add'):
                    filelog = self.p4.run_filelog('-m1', '{}#{}'.format(chRev.depotFile, chRev.rev))
                    if filelog:
                        self.logger.debug('filelog', filelog)
                        depotFile = filelog[0]
                        revision = depotFile.revisions[0]
                        if len(revision.integrations) > 0:
                            for integ in revision.integrations:
                                if 'from' in integ.how or integ.how == "ignored":
                                    chRev.setIntegrationInfo(integ)
                                    integ.localFile = self.localmap.translate(integ.file)
                                    break
                        if chRev.action == 'move/add':
                            self.logger.debug('integration', chRev.integration)
                            movetracker.trackAdd(chRev, localFile, depotFile.depotFile, chRev.integration.localFile)
                        else:
                            filerevs.append(chRev)
                    else:
                        self.logger.error(u"Failed to retrieve filelog for {}#{}".format(chRev.depotFile, 
                                            chRev.rev))
                elif chRev.action == 'move/delete':
                    movetracker.trackDelete(chRev, localFile)
                else:
                    filerevs.append(chRev)
        filerevs.extend(movetracker.getMoves())
        return filerevs

class P4Target(P4Base):
    "Functionality for transferring changes to target Perforce repository"
    
    def __init__(self, section, options, src):
        super(P4Target, self).__init__(section, options, 'targ')
        self.src = src
        self.re_cant_integ = None

    def replicateChange(self, filerevs, change, sourcePort):
        """This is the heart of it all. Replicate all changes according to their description"""

        for f in filerevs:
            self.logger.debug('targ:', f)

            if not self.options.preview:
                if f.action == 'edit':
                    self.logger.debug('processing:0010 edit')
                    self.p4cmd('sync', '-k', f.localFile)
                    self.p4cmd('edit', '-t', f.type, f.localFile)
                    self.checkWarnings('edit')
                elif f.action == 'add':
                    if 'integration' in f.__dict__:
                        self.replicateBranch(f, dirty=True)
                    else:
                        self.logger.debug('processing:0020 add')
                        self.p4cmd('add', '-ft', f.type, f.fixedLocalFile)
                        self.checkWarnings('add')
                elif f.action == 'delete':
                    if 'integration' in f.__dict__:
                        self.replicateIntegration(f)
                        self.checkWarnings('integrate (delete)')
                    else:
                        self.logger.debug('processing:0030 delete')
                        self.p4cmd('delete', '-v', f.localFile)
                        self.checkWarnings('delete')
                elif f.action == 'purge':
                    # special case. Type of file is +S, and source.sync removed the file
                    # create a temporary file, it will be overwritten again later
                    self.logger.debug('processing:0040 purge')
                    dummy = open(f.localFile, 'w')
                    dummy.write('purged file')
                    dummy.close()
                    self.p4cmd('sync', '-k', f.localFile)
                    self.p4cmd('edit', '-t', f.type, f.localFile)
                    if self.p4.warnings:
                        self.p4cmd('add', '-tf', f.type, f.fixedLocalFile)
                        self.checkWarnings('purge -add')
                elif f.action == 'branch':
                    self.replicateBranch(f, dirty=False)
                    self.checkWarnings('branch')
                elif f.action == 'integrate':
                    self.replicateIntegration(f)
                    self.checkWarnings('integrate')
                elif f.action == 'move/add':
                    self.moveAdd(f)
                else:
                    raise Exception('Unknown action: %s for %s' % (
                                f.action, str(f)))
        newChangeId = None

        opened = self.p4cmd('opened')
        if len(opened) > 0:
            description = change['desc'] \
                + '''

Transferred from p4://%s@%s''' % (sourcePort,
                    change['change'])

            if self.options.nokeywords:
                self.removeKeywords(opened)

            result = self.p4cmd('submit', '-d', description)

            # the submit information can be followed by refreshFile lines
            # need to go backwards to find submittedChange

            a = -1
            while 'submittedChange' not in result[a]:
                a -= 1
            newChangeId = result[a]['submittedChange']
            self.updateChange(change, newChangeId)
            self.reverifyRevisions(result)

        self.logger.info("source = {} : target = {}".format(change['change'], newChangeId))
        return newChangeId
        
    def moveAdd(self, file):
        "Either paired with a move/delete or an orphaned move/add"
        self.logger.debug('processing:0100 move/add')
        if file.integration and file.integration.localFile:
            source = file.integration.localFile
            self.p4cmd('sync', '-f', source)
            self.p4cmd('edit', source)
            if os.path.exists(file.localFile):
                self.p4cmd('move', '-k', source, file.localFile)
            else:
                self.p4cmd('move', source, file.localFile)
        else:
            self.p4cmd('add', '-ft', file.type, file.fixedLocalFile)
            self.checkWarnings('add')
            
    def updateChange(self, change, newChangeId):
        # need to update the user and time stamp
        newChange = self.p4.fetch_change(newChangeId)
        newChange._user = change['user']
        # date in change is in epoch time, we need it in canonical form
        newDate = datetime.utcfromtimestamp(int(change['time'])).strftime("%Y/%m/%d %H:%M:%S")
        newChange._date = newDate
        self.p4.save_change(newChange, '-f')

    def reverifyRevisions(self, result):
        revisionsToVerify = ["{file}#{rev},{rev}".format(file=x['refreshFile'], rev=x['refreshRev'])
                                for x in result if 'refreshFile' in x]
        if revisionsToVerify:
            self.p4cmd('verify', '-qv', revisionsToVerify)

    def removeKeywords(self, opened):
        for openFile in opened:
            if self.hasKeyword(openFile["type"]):
                fileType = self.removeKeyword(openFile["type"])

                self.p4.run_reopen('-t', fileType, openFile["depotFile"])

                self.logger.debug("targ: Changed type from {} to {} for {}".
                                format(openFile["type"], fileType, openFile["depotFile"]))

    KTEXT = re.compile("(.*)\+([^k]*)k([^k]*)")

    def hasKeyword(self, fileType):
        return(fileType in ["ktext", "kxtext"] or self.KTEXT.match(fileType))

    def removeKeyword(self, fileType):
        if fileType == "ktext":
            newType = "text"
        elif fileType == "kxtext":
            newType = "xtext"
        else:
            m = self.KTEXT.match(fileType)
            newType = m.group(1) + "+" + m.group(2) + m.group(3)

        return newType

    def replicateBranch(self, file, dirty=False):
        # An integration where source has been obliterated will not have integrations
        if not self.re_cant_integ:
            self.re_cant_integ = re.compile("can't integrate from .* or use -Di to disregard move")
        self.logger.debug('replicateBranch')
        has_integration = False
        try:
            i = file.integration
            has_integration = True
        except:
            pass
        if has_integration and not self.options.ignore and file.integration.localFile:
            if file.integration.how == 'add from':
                self.logger.debug('processing:0200 add from')
                self.p4cmd('add', '-ft', file.type, file.fixedLocalFile)
            else:
                self.logger.debug('processing:0210 integrate')
                output = self.p4cmd('integrate', '-v', file.integration.localFile, file.localFile)
                if self.re_cant_integ.search(str(output)):
                    output = self.p4cmd('integrate', '-v', '-Di', file.integration.localFile, file.localFile)
                if dirty:
                    self.p4cmd('edit', file.localFile)
        else:
            self.logger.debug('processing:0220 add')
            self.p4cmd('add', '-ft', file.type, file.fixedLocalFile)

    def replicateIntegration(self, file):
        self.logger.debug('replicateIntegration')
        if not self.options.ignore and file.integration.localFile:
            if file.integration.how == 'edit from':
                self.logger.debug('processing:0300 edit from')
                with open(file.localFile) as f:
                    content = f.read()
                self.p4cmd('sync', '-f', file.localFile)    # to avoid tamper checking
                self.p4cmd('integrate', file.integration.localFile, file.localFile)

                class MyResolver(P4.Resolver):
                    "Local resolver to accept edits on merge"
                    def __init__(self, content):
                        self.content = content

                    def resolve(self, mergeData):
                        with open(mergeData.result_path, 'w') as f:
                            f.write(self.content)
                        return 'ae'

                self.p4.run_resolve(resolver=MyResolver(content))
            else:
                self.logger.debug('processing:0310 integrate')
                self.p4cmd('sync', '-f', file.localFile)    # to avoid tamper checking
                self.p4cmd('integrate', file.integration.localFile, file.localFile)
                if file.integration.how == 'copy from':
                    self.logger.debug('processing:0320 copy from')
                    self.p4cmd('resolve', '-at')
                elif file.integration.how == 'ignored':
                    self.logger.debug('processing:0330 ignored')
                    self.p4cmd('resolve', '-ay')
                elif file.integration.how in ('delete', 'delete from'):
                    self.logger.debug('processing:0340 delete')
                    self.p4cmd('resolve', '-at')
                elif file.integration.how == 'merge from':
                    self.logger.debug('processing:0350 merge from')
                    # self.p4cmd('edit(file.localFile) # to overcome tamper check
                    self.p4cmd('resolve', '-am')
                else:
                    self.logger.error('Cannot deal with {}'.format(file.integration))
        else:
            self.logger.debug('processing:0360 ignore integrations')
            if file.integration.how in ('delete', 'delete from'):
                self.logger.debug('processing:0370 delete')
                self.p4cmd('delete', '-v', file.localFile)
            else:
                self.logger.debug('processing:0380 else')
                self.p4cmd('sync', '-k', file.localFile)
                self.p4cmd('edit', file.localFile)

    def getCounter(self):
        "Returns value of counter as integer"
        result = self.p4cmd('counter', self.options.counter_name)
        if result and 'counter' in result[0]:
            return int(result[0]['value'])
        return 0

    def setCounter(self, value):
        "Set's the counter to specified value"
        self.p4cmd('counter', self.options.counter_name, str(value))

class P4Transfer(object):
    "Main transfer class"

    def __init__(self, *args):
        parser = argparse.ArgumentParser(
            description="P4Transfer",
            epilog="Copyright (C) 2012-14 Sven Erik Knop/Robert Cowham, Perforce Software Ltd"
        )

        parser.add_argument('-n', '--preview', action='store_true', help="Preview only, no transfer")
        parser.add_argument('-c', '--config', default=CONFIG, help="Default is " + CONFIG)
        parser.add_argument('-m', '--maximum', default=None, type=int, help="Maximum number of changes to transfer")
        parser.add_argument('-k', '--nokeywords', action='store_true', help="Do not expand keywords and remove +k from filetype")
        parser.add_argument('-p', '--preflight', action='store_true', help="Run a sanity check first to ensure target is empty")
        parser.add_argument('-r', '--repeat', action='store_true', help="Repeat transfer in a loop - for continuous transfer")
        parser.add_argument('-s', '--stoponerror', action='store_true', help="Stop on any error even if --repeat has been specified")
        parser.add_argument('--sample_config', action='store_true', help="Print an example config file and exit")
        parser.add_argument('-i', '--ignore', action='store_true', help="Treat integrations as adds and edits")

        self.options = parser.parse_args(list(args))
        self.options.sync_progress_size_interval = None

        self.logger = logutils.getLogger(LOGGER_NAME)
        self.previous_target_change_counter = 0 # Current value

    def getOption(self, section, option_name, default=None):
        result = default
        try:
            result = self.parser.get(section, option_name)
        except:
            pass
        return result

    def getIntOption(self, section, option_name, default=None):
        result = default
        strval = self.getOption(section, option_name, default)
        if strval:
            try:
                result = int(eval(strval))
            except:
                pass
        return result

    def readConfig(self):
        self.parser = ConfigParser()
        self.options.parser = self.parser    # for later use
        try:
            with open(self.options.config) as f:
                if python3:
                    self.parser.read_file(f)
                else:
                    self.parser.readfp(f)
        except Exception as e:
            raise Exception('Could not read %s: %s' % (self.options.config, str(e)))

        self.options.counter_name = self.getOption(GENERAL_SECTION, "counter_name")
        if not self.options.counter_name:
            raise Exception("Option counter_name in the [general] section must be specified")
        self.options.instance_name = self.getOption(GENERAL_SECTION, "instance_name", self.options.counter_name)
        self.options.mail_form_url = self.getOption(GENERAL_SECTION, "mail_form_url")
        self.options.mail_to = self.getOption(GENERAL_SECTION, "mail_to")
        self.options.mail_from = self.getOption(GENERAL_SECTION, "mail_from")
        self.options.mail_server = self.getOption(GENERAL_SECTION, "mail_server")
        self.options.sleep_on_error_interval = self.getIntOption(GENERAL_SECTION, "sleep_on_error_interval", 60)
        self.options.poll_interval = self.getIntOption(GENERAL_SECTION, "poll_interval", 60)
        self.options.report_interval = self.getIntOption(GENERAL_SECTION, "report_interval", 30)
        self.options.error_report_interval = self.getIntOption(GENERAL_SECTION, "error_report_interval", 30)
        self.options.summary_report_interval = self.getIntOption(GENERAL_SECTION, "summary_report_interval", 10080)
        self.options.sync_progress_size_interval = self.getIntOption(GENERAL_SECTION,
                    "sync_progress_size_interval")

        self.source = P4Source(SOURCE_SECTION, self.options)
        self.target = P4Target(TARGET_SECTION, self.options, self.source)

        self.readSection(self.source)
        self.readSection(self.target)

    def readSection(self, p4config):
        if self.parser.has_section(p4config.section):
            self.readOptions(p4config)
        else:
            raise Exception('Config file needs section %s' % p4config.section)

    def readOptions(self, p4config):
        self.readOption('P4CLIENT', p4config)
        self.readOption('P4USER', p4config)
        self.readOption('P4PORT', p4config)
        self.readOption('P4PASSWD', p4config, optional=True)

    def readOption(self, option, p4config, optional=False):
        if self.parser.has_option(p4config.section, option):
            p4config.__dict__[option] = self.parser.get(p4config.section, option)
        elif not optional:
            raise Exception('Required option %s not found in section %s' % (option, p4config.section))

    def replicate_changes(self):
        "Perform a replication loop"
        self.source.connect('source replicate')
        self.target.connect('target replicate')
        changes = self.source.missingChanges(self.target.getCounter())
        self.logger.info("Transferring %d changes" % len(changes))
        if len(changes) > 0:
            self.save_previous_target_change_counter()
            self.source.progress = ReportProgress(self.source.p4, changes, self.logger)
            self.source.progress.SetSyncProgressSizeInterval(self.options.sync_progress_size_interval)
            for change in changes:
                msg = 'Processing change: {} "{}"'.format(change['change'], change['desc'].strip())
                self.logger.info(msg)
                filerevs = self.source.getChange(change['change'])
                self.target.replicateChange(filerevs, change, self.source.p4.port)
                self.target.setCounter(change['change'])
                # Tidy up the workspaces after successful transfer
                self.source.p4cmd("sync", "#0")
                self.target.p4cmd("sync", "#0")
        self.source.disconnect()
        self.target.disconnect()
        return len(changes)

    def log_exception(self, e):
        "Log exceptions appropriately"
        etext = str(e)
        if re.search("WSAETIMEDOUT", etext, re.MULTILINE) or re.search("WSAECONNREFUSED", etext, re.MULTILINE):
            self.logger.error(etext)
        else:
            self.logger.exception(e)

    def save_previous_target_change_counter(self):
        "Save the latest change transferred to the target"
        chg = self.target.p4cmd('changes', '-m1', '-ssubmitted', '//{client}/...'.format(client=self.target.P4CLIENT))
        if chg:
            self.previous_target_change_counter = int(chg[0]['change']) + 1

    def send_summary_email(self, time_last_summary_sent, change_last_summary_sent):
        "Send an email summarising changes transferred"
        time_str = p4time(time_last_summary_sent)
        self.target.connect('target replicate')
        # Combine changes reported by time or since last changelist transferred
        changes = self.target.p4cmd('changes', '-l', '//{client}/...@{rev},#head'.format(
                client=self.target.P4CLIENT, rev=time_str))
        chgnums = [chg['change'] for chg in changes]
        counter_changes = self.target.p4cmd('changes', '-l', '//{client}/...@{rev},#head'.format(
                client=self.target.P4CLIENT, rev=change_last_summary_sent))
        for chg in counter_changes:
            if chg['change'] not in chgnums:
                changes.append(chg)
        changes.reverse()
        lines = []
        lines.append(["Date", "Time", "Changelist", "File Revisions", "Size (bytes)", "Size"])
        total_changes = 0
        total_rev_count = 0
        total_file_sizes = 0
        for chg in changes:
            sizes = self.target.p4cmd('sizes', '-s', '@%s,%s' % (chg['change'], chg['change']))
            lines.append([time.strftime("%Y/%m/%d", time.localtime(int(chg['time']))),
                         time.strftime("%H:%M:%S", time.localtime(int(chg['time']))),
                         chg['change'], sizes[0]['fileCount'], sizes[0]['fileSize'],
                         fmtsize(int(sizes[0]['fileSize']))])
            total_changes += 1
            total_rev_count += int(sizes[0]['fileCount'])
            total_file_sizes += int(sizes[0]['fileSize'])
        lines.append([])
        lines.append(['Totals', '', str(total_changes), str(total_rev_count), str(total_file_sizes), fmtsize(total_file_sizes)])
        report = "Changes transferred since %s\n%s" % (time_str,
                "\n".join(["\t".join(line) for line in lines]))
        self.logger.debug("Transfer summary report:\n%s" % report)
        self.logger.info("Sending Transfer summary report")
        self.logger.notify("Transfer summary report", report, include_output=False)
        self.save_previous_target_change_counter()
        self.target.disconnect()

    #
    # This is the central method
    # It provides the replication process
    # Algorithm:
    #     Read the config file
    #     Connect to server1 and server
    #     Determine if counter is there
    def replicate(self):
        """Central method that performs the replication between server1 and server2"""
        if self.options.sample_config:
            printSampleConfig()
            return 0
        try:
            logOnce(self.logger, VERSION)
            logOnce(self.logger, "Reading config file")
            self.readConfig()
            self.source.connect('source replicate')
            self.target.connect('target replicate')
            self.logger.debug("connected to source and target")
            if not self.source.root == self.target.root:
                raise Exception('server1 and server2 workspace root directories must be the same')
        except Exception as e:
            self.log_exception(e)
            logging.shutdown()
            return 1
        # self.source.resetWorkspace()

        if self.options.preflight:
            print("Running pre-flight check first ...")
            targetFiles = self.target.p4cmd('fstat', '-T clientFile', '...')
            sourceFiles = self.source.p4cmd('fstat', '-T clientFile', '...')

            for f in targetFiles:
                if f in sourceFiles:
                    depotFile = self.target.p4cmd('fstat', f['clientFile'])[0]
                    raise Exception("Failed pre-flight check, file '{}' in source and target".format(depotFile['depotFile']))
            print("Finished pre-flight check ...")

        time_last_summary_sent = time.time()
        change_last_summary_sent = 0
        self.logger.debug("Time last summary sent: %s" % p4time(time_last_summary_sent))
        time_last_error_occurred = 0
        error_encountered = False # Flag to indicate error encountered which may require reporting
        error_notified = False
        finished = False
        while not finished:
            try:
                self.readConfig()       # Read every time to allow user to change them
                self.logger.setReportingOptions(instance_name=self.options.instance_name,
                                mail_form_url=self.options.mail_form_url, mail_to=self.options.mail_to,
                                mail_from=self.options.mail_from, mail_server=self.options.mail_server,
                                report_interval=self.options.report_interval)
                logOnce(self.logger, self.source.options)
                logOnce(self.logger, self.target.options)
                self.source.disconnect()
                self.target.disconnect()
                num_changes = self.replicate_changes()
                if num_changes > 0:
                    self.logger.info("Transferred %d changes successfully" % num_changes)
                if change_last_summary_sent == 0:
                    change_last_summary_sent = self.previous_target_change_counter
                if not self.options.repeat:
                    finished = True
                else:
                    if error_encountered:
                        self.logger.info("Logging - reset error interval")
                        self.logger.notify("Cleared error", "Previous error has now been cleared")
                        error_encountered = False
                        error_notified = False
                    if time.time() - time_last_summary_sent > self.options.summary_report_interval * 60:
                        time_last_summary_sent = time.time()
                        self.send_summary_email(time_last_summary_sent, change_last_summary_sent)
                    self.logger.info("Sleeping for %d minutes" % self.options.poll_interval)
                    time.sleep(self.options.poll_interval * 60)
            except Exception as e:
                self.log_exception(e)
                if self.options.stoponerror:
                    self.logger.notify("Error", "Exception encountered and --stoponerror specified")
                    logging.shutdown()
                    return 1
                else:
                    # Decide whether to report an error
                    if not error_encountered:
                        error_encountered = True
                        time_last_error_occurred = time.time()
                    elif not error_notified:
                        if time.time() - time_last_error_occurred > self.options.error_report_interval * 60:
                            error_notified = True
                            self.logger.info("Logging - Notifying recurring error")
                            self.logger.notify("Recurring error", "Multiple errors seen")
                    self.logger.info("Sleeping on error for %d minutes" % self.options.sleep_on_error_interval)
                    time.sleep(self.options.sleep_on_error_interval * 60)
        self.logger.notify("Changes transferred", "Completed successfully")
        logging.shutdown()
        return 0

if __name__ == '__main__':
    result = 0
    try:
        prog = P4Transfer(*sys.argv[1:])
        result = prog.replicate()
    except Exception as e:
        print(str(e))
        result = 1
    sys.exit(result)
